Oil & Gas UK has appointed Neil McCulloch and Terry Savage as its new co-chairmen. Mr McCulloch, North Sea president at EnQuest, said the industry had to achieve average unit operating costs of $15, and drilling costs of less than half their peak level. Mr Savage, corporate relationship director at Global Energy Group, said a “change in culture and behaviours” was needed for the UK Continental Shelf to have a sustainable future. Ray Riddoch (Nexen Petroleum) and Neil Sims (Expro) take over as vice-chairmen, while new board members are Mark Thomas (BP), Walter Thain (Petrofac) and Morton Kelstrup (Maersk Oil).
